Calculating Your Bonus
Bonuses are not as simple as “get 100% match.” To understand the real value, you need to calculate the effective bonus amount and the playthrough requirement. Let’s assume the casino offers a welcome bonus of 100% up to €100, with a 30x wagering requirement on the bonus amount, and a 30x on the deposit amount. Here is how you calculate:
Important: All wagering requirements are subject to the casino’s terms; always verify the current offer.
If you deposit €50, your bonus match is 100% of €50 = €50. Your total balance becomes €100 (deposit + bonus). The wagering requirement is typically the sum of (deposit × 30) + (bonus × 30) = (€50 × 30) + (€50 × 30) = €1,500 + €1,500 = €3,000. You must wager a total of €3,000 before you can withdraw any winnings from that bonus.
Now, let’s calculate the expected loss during the wagering process. If you play a slot with a return-to-player (RTP) of 96%, the house edge is 4%. So, the expected loss during wagering is 4% of €3,000 = €120. Since your total bonus is only €50, the expected value (EV) of this bonus is negative: EV = Bonus – Expected Loss = €50 – €120 = –€70. This means on average you will lose €70 of your own money. However, if the game has a higher RTP (e.g., 98%), the expected loss is 2% of €3,000 = €60, and EV = –€10. Always check the game contribution percentages, as some games (like blackjack) count less toward wagering.
To maximize your chances, choose games with the highest RTP and read the bonus terms for max bet limits (typically €5 per spin) and time limits (usually 30 days). If you deposit €100 instead, the bonus is €100 (since it’s up to €100), and wagering requirement = (€100 × 30) + (€100 × 30) = €6,000. The expected loss at 96% RTP is €240, so EV = –€140. As you can see, larger bonuses often come with higher wagering loads, so always calculate before claiming.
Banking & Payments
Managing your money efficiently is key. The casino supports various deposit and withdrawal methods, each with different processing times and fees. Below is a table summarizing common options:
| Payment Method | Deposit Time | Withdrawal Time | Fees |
|---|---|---|---|
| Credit/Debit Card | Instant | 3–5 business days | None |
| Skrill/Neteller | Instant | 12–24 hours | None |
| Bank Transfer | 1–3 business days | 5–10 business days | Possible bank charges |
| PaySafeCard | Instant | Not available for withdrawals | None |
When you request a withdrawal, the casino first verifies your identity (KYC) and then processes the payment. Withdrawals to cards are usually free, but note that your bank may charge a foreign transaction fee if the casino is based in another currency zone. Always check the withdrawal limits: they are typically €500 per transaction and €5,000 per week, but these vary. If you win a jackpot, the casino may pay in installments.
To avoid delays, use the same payment method for deposits and withdrawals, as casinos often require this as an anti-money laundering measure. Also, ensure that you have completed KYC before requesting a large withdrawal — otherwise, your account may be flagged.

When Things Go Wrong
Even with the best precautions, issues can arise. Here are common scenarios and how to handle them:
- Forgot password: Use the “Forgot Password” link on the login page. You will receive a reset link by email. Follow the instructions to create a new password.
- Withdrawal stuck in “pending”: This happens when you haven’t completed KYC. Submit your documents (passport, utility bill, card copy) in the Cashier or Profile section. If the issue persists, contact support via live chat.
- Bonus wasn’t credited: Check if you entered the bonus code correctly or if the bonus is auto-triggered after your first deposit. If you made the deposit before reading the terms, you might have opted out. Contact support to request retroactive opt-in.
- Game freezes or crashes: Refresh your browser or clear your cache. For login issues, try a different browser or disable your ad-blocker. If the problem continues, the casino’s tech team may be at fault — contact support.
- Disagreement over a bet: Always keep a screenshot of your play history. Contact support with the date, time, and bet details. Disputes are resolved within 48 hours, but if you are unsatisfied, you can escalate to the licensing authority (MGA or Curacao).
- Account temporarily locked: This is often due to suspicious activity or after a chargeback. Contact support immediately and be ready to provide identification. An account review usually takes 2–5 business days.
Remember to document all communication with the casino’s customer support, including chat transcripts and emails, to protect your rights.
